History of Lotteries

The first recorded lotteries were held in China during the Han Dynasty between 205 and 187 BC, and were believed to help fund major government projects. However, they were a source of great controversy.

Unlike traditional raffles, which essentially sell tickets to win prizes, modern state lotteries are designed to generate large amounts of revenue with minimal risk. These revenues are typically used for public benefit and, as a result, become very popular with the general public. In fact, the majority of adults in states that have a lottery regularly play them.

Some states have banned lotteries altogether, and there are still some people in the US who believe that they are a form of taxation. This belief may be based on the fact that most lotteries offer no prizes to those who don’t win, and instead pay the prize money in equal annual installments over 20 years.

The lottery industry has also been accused of being deceptive by providing misleading information about the odds of winning a jackpot, inflating their own profits and lowering the real value of the winnings over time. Moreover, many states have taxes that will dramatically erode the worth of a lottery win.
